Cats communicate through vocalization, but excessive whining or crying beyond their normal pattern indicates discomfort. Pain, anxiety, hyperthyroidism, high blood pressure, cognitive dysfunction, and unspayed female heat cycles are common causes. Your vet personalizes the plan after assessing your pet — these are common approaches, not DIY prescriptions.
Pain relief for arthritis or dental discomfort
Anti-anxiety medication (gabapentin, fluoxetine)
Selegiline (Anipryl) for cognitive dysfunction
Blood pressure medication for hypertension
Hyperthyroidism treatment if overactive thyroid is suspected
Environmental enrichment and night-time routine adjustments
Spay referral for unspayed females in heat
